This series will prepare you for the MCTS: Windows Server 2008 Network Infrastructure, Configuring exam. This exam is the only requirement to apply for the Microsoft Certified Technology Specialist: Windows Server 2008 Network Infrastructure Configuration certification. This study guide will prepare you to monitor a Windows Server 2008 system, as well as configure IP addressing, name resolution, network access, and file and print services. Practice exams are also included, which will allow you to answer questions in the same format that the test will use on exam day, and will provide in-depth instructional feedback on each question to thoroughly cover every subject you'll need to master.
Certification:
The tests that this series prepares students to take are a part of earning the Microsoft Certified Technology Specialist (MCTS): Windows Server 2008 Network Infrastructure, Configuring, Microsoft Certified IT Professional (MCITP): Enterprise Administrator, and Microsoft Certified IT Professional (MCITP): Server Administrator certifications.
Audience:
This series is for anyone who wants to achieve MCTS 70-642 certification.
